The Skidmore College Department of Theater has announced its Fall 2013 production, AMERICAN COLLISION(S). This production is a devised piece directed by Carolyn Anderson. Performances are October 16-18, 2013. All shows are in the Frances Young Tang Teaching Museum and Art Gallery on the Skidmore College campus at 7:00pm and 9:00pm
SongFest is a festival for singers and collaborative pianists, which covers all aspects of the art of song: musical interpretation, literary interpretation, and effective public presentation. Master classes are taught to singers and pianists by distinguished artists of international stature. Each master class focuses thematically on specific vocal repertoire, presenting and studying it in new and challenging contexts.
Anna Kustera Gallery is pleased to present 'Water, Liquor, Hair', a solo exhibition of paintings by Julia Jacquette. Known for virtuoso technique and a fascination with media images, Jacquette makes paintings about wish fulfillment in a consumerist society.

A special exhibition featuring 90 exquisite objects that once adorned an exclusive compound in the Forbidden City will go on view at The Metropolitan Museum of Art beginning February 1, 2011.
